500 error on clicking at cornersone link

Hi,

I’ve changed the URLs of my WP site, that is hosted on Bluehost and since that I get the error 500 when I click at the cornerstone link on the menu.

The site is hosted under this URL: http://www.specialize.com.br

I’ve used the | define(‘WP_DEBUG’, true); | to try to find something wrong but nothing until now.

How should I proceed in order to make it work again?

Please try out following solutions and let us know the outcome:

  1. Please navigate to Settings > Permalinks, select post name and click on Save Changes. See if Cornerstone is working. If it is then rollback the Permalinks to earlier state and test the case again.
  2. Test for a plugin conflict. You can do this by deactivating all third-party plugins, and see if the problem remains. If it’s fixed, you’ll know a plugin caused the problem, and you can narrow down which one by reactivating them one at a time.
  3. Increase the PHP Memory Limit of your server. Click here for more detailed information and how to increase the PHP memory limit.

The #1 solved the problem.
